In this video, I would like to talk about Navigating Your Path to Study: Obtaining a Provincial Attestation Letter (PAL) in international students with aspirations to study in Manitoba, Canada, securing a Provincial Attestation Letter (PAL) is a crucial step towards obtaining a study permit. This recently implemented system acts as a confirmation from the Manitoba government that you've been accepted into a designated learning institution (DLI) within the province. As of March 4th, 2024, the Immigration, Refugees and Citizenship Canada (IRCC) officially recognized Manitoba's participation in the PAL program. Research and apply to DLIs that align with your academic goals. Upon receiving an offer of admission, carefully review and accept specifics might vary, some Manitoba DLIs might require a deposit from you after accepting your offer of admission. This deposit signifies your firm intention to study at their institution. Check with your chosen DLI's international student services department for their specific requirements.
